Jason Mewes and Brian O’Halloran Announced for Astronomicon; Sid Haig Cancels All February Appearances [Details Inside]

We are only TWO DAYS AWAY from the inaugural pop culture event: Astronomicon!  There have been some last-minute lineup changes as of last night, so first, I’ll tell you about a little staleness.

It seems as though Sid Haig who plays Captain Spaulding on the silver screen has had to not only cancel his appearance at Astronomicon, but ALL February appearances due to professional obligations. That also means that he will not be conducting the wedding of our homie Andy Sherman, and any others that were scheduled this weekend.  Those who prepaid for autographs should have already been refunded.

Now, the GOOD news is that there have been some awesome additions to the lineup!  Both Jason Mewes and Brian O’Halloran will be there, in the flesh!  If you’re not familiar with the names, you may recognize Jason from Clerks 1&2, Mall Rats, Big Money Ru$tla$ and Jay and Silent Bob Strike Back!  Brian can be seen in Clerks 1&2, Mallrats, and Dogma!
